    Kinase Targets and Drug Discovery covers the critical role of kinases as regulators of cellular functions and their implications in a range of diseases, from cancers to cardiovascular disorders and inflammatory conditions. Readers will explore foundational concepts on the functions of kinases, the role of kinase inhibitors in disease therapy, and challenges faced. The second section focuses on innovative strategies in kinase drug discovery, covering screening and computational approaches, along with the development of covalent, macrocyclic, allosteric inhibitors, and kinase degraders. Final sections examine clinical applications, detailing how kinase inhibition can be harnessed for cancer therapies, non-oncologic diseases, and even non-catalytic functions.This book will serve as an indispensable resource for pharmacologists, medicinal chemists, and researchers in both academia and industry.     Computer-Aided Drug Design in Modern Drug Discovery offers an in-depth exploration of CADD, featuring real-world case studies and practical examples that empower researchers to effectively harness this technology in drug discovery and development. Exploring the intricacies of CADD, the book comprises several key chapters, beginning with an introduction to its methods and evolution that is followed by a thorough examination of the integration of artificial intelligence in drug design. Subsequent chapters cover various CADD approaches, including ligand-based, structure-based, and fragment-based design, alongside AI-driven compound generation and drug screening.The book also showcases a selection of marketed drugs developed with CADD or AI, such as Captopril, Tirofiban, and Crizotinib, providing invaluable insights into the successes and challenges faced in real-world applications. Finally, the discussion of emerging trends and future directions in CADD and AI highlights the ongoing evolution of these methodologies and their integration with traditional drug development processes.

    Chalcones: From Drug Discovery to Pharmaceutical Applications serves as a comprehensive reference on chalcones, detailing their natural occurrence, synthetic methods, and therapeutic applications. The book provides both novice and experienced researchers with the foundational knowledge necessary to advance their work in this area. Sections cover the natural sources of chalcones, various extraction methods, structural characterization techniques, synthesis, and their role in organic chemistry and metal complexes, while also addressing pharmacokinetic properties, toxicity, and the medicinal uses of chalcones, including their effectiveness against viruses, bacteria, cancer, and neurodegenerative diseases. Final sections explore chalcone-containing products, drug formulation strategies, and clinical trials involving chalcone-based drug candidates.     Emerging Trends in Phytotherapy of Cancer is an essential reference that explores the multifaceted role of medicinal plants in combating cancer. The book covers a broad range of interconnected topics including ethnomedicinal plants used in cancer by tribes and aboriginals, herbs used in Ayurvedic medicine for cancer, integrated approaches of modern and conventional drugs, anti-cancerous secondary metabolites, plant-based anticancer drugs approved by FDA and WHO, toxicity to humans, and the role of emerging technologies such as the applications of nanotechnology and artificial intelligence. The contents are divided into six parts. Part one opens with an introductory chapter, followed by the different combinations of plant-based drugs and modern medicine for cancer treatment, and recent developments in cancer research. Part two discusses the ethnomedicinal uses of plants in cancer and the role of Ayurvedic herbal medicines in cancer. Part three incorporates the role of secondary metabolites in cancer treatment. Part four elaborates on the plant-based drugs recommended by FDA/WHO. Part five concerns the human phytotoxicity of secondary metabolites, and part six describes the role of emerging nanotechnologies and artificial intelligence in phytotherapy drug delivery and treatment.     Deep Learning in Drug Design: Methods and Applications summarizes the most recent methods, and technological advances of deep learning for drug design, which mainly consists of molecular representations, the architectures of deep learning, geometric deep learning, large models, etc., as well as deep learning applications in various aspects of drug design. This book offers a comprehensive academic overview of deep learning in drug design. It begins with molecular representations, CNNs, GNNs, Transformers, generative models, explainable AI, large models, etc. Next, it covers deep learning applications like protein structure prediction, molecular interactions, ADMET prediction, antibody design, and so on. Finally, a separate chapter is dedicated to the introduction of the ethics and regulation of artificial intelligence in drug design.
